Texas HB1693 mandates financial audits of open-enrollment charter schools receiving over $100 million in state revenue.
Texas HB1693 requires the State Auditor to consider performing audits on open-enrollment charter schools that receive more than $100 million in state revenue annually. The State Auditor may collaborate with the State Board of Education during these audits. The scope of these audits may be limited to charter schools deemed to pose the highest financial risk to the state. This Act takes effect September 1, 2025.
